Complexation between molybdenum(VI) and oxalate: Crystal and molecular structure of [(−)Co(en)3][MoO3(C2O4)OH2]I·2 H2O

Abstract

The crystal structure of the product of the reaction between [(−)Co(en)3]I3 and a mixture of Na2MoO4 and NaHC2O4 in aqueous solution is reported: [(−)Co(en)3][MoO3(C2O4)OH2]I·2H2O, space groupP212121,a=8.131(2),b=14.590(4),c=17.509(4) Å;Z=4. FinalR=0.048,R w=0.050,w=(σ 2 F)−1 for 1899 reflections. The configuration of the Mo(VI) oxalate complex differs notably from that proposed previously on the basis of chemical analysis and equilibrium studies.
